Navigating European Market Access for Women's Outdoor Winter Technical Outerwear & Protective Apparel
In global outerwear manufacturing, achieving CE Certification for Women's Outdoor Winter Jackets represents far more than a compliance badge—it is a rigorous, multi-tiered engineering threshold governed by Regulation (EU) 2016/425 for Personal Protective Equipment (PPE). Importers, brand owners, and institutional corporate buyers across Europe must ensure every thermal garment meets non-negotiable thermal insulation, hydrostatic resistance, micro-porous breathability, and ergonomic durability standards.
Our manufacturing matrix incorporates mandatory test protocols verified by accredited Notified Bodies (such as SGS, TÜV Rheinland, and Intertek):
| Regulatory Standard | Technical Parameter Tested | Engineering Compliance Level | Testing Protocol / Certification |
|---|---|---|---|
| EN 342:2017 | Thermal Insulation ($I_{cler}$) & Air Permeability | Class 3 Air Permeability ($< 5\text{ mm/s}$), $I_{cler} > 0.310\text{ m}^2\cdot\text{K/W}$ | Thermal Manikin Test (ISO 15831) |
| EN 343:2019 | Hydrostatic Head & Vapor Resistance ($R_{et}$) | Class 4 Water Penetration ($\ge 20,000\text{ Pa}$ before pre-treatment) | Hydrostatic Pressure (ISO 811) |
| EN ISO 20471 | High-Visibility Retro-Reflective Performance | Class 2 / Class 3 Surface Luminance & 3M™ Micro-prismatic Tape | Photometric & Colorimetric Audit |
| EU REACH Annex XVII | Chemical Innocuousness & PFC-Free DWR | Zero Detection of PFOA, PFOS, Heavy Metals (< 0.1 ppm) | GC-MS & LC-MS Laboratory Testing |
The Evolution of Female-Specific Alpine Outerwear, Circular Fabrics, and Smart Thermal Architecture
Traditional unisex sizing fails to accommodate physiological center-of-gravity shifts, dynamic shoulder rotation, and waist-to-hip proportions essential for alpine maneuverability. Our pattern makers utilize 3D CLO digital mapping to create articulated elbow gussets, tapered drop-tails, and non-restrictive bust grading.
Global brands are shifting rapidly toward Global Recycled Standard (GRS) certified face fabrics, post-consumer PET laminates, and bio-based polyurethane membranes. We integrate solution-dyed yarns that reduce water consumption by 80% and carbon emissions by 45% during the mill processing stage.
By pairing 800-fill power Responsible Down Standard (RDS) goose down around core chest cavities with hydrophobic recycled synthetic insulation at high-sweat zones (underarms and spine), our jackets achieve maximum CLO warmth-to-weight ratios without moisture accumulation.

From Raw Membrane Lamination to Ultrasonic Seam Sealing: How We Guarantee Zero Failure Rates
Computerized CAD nesting achieves over 88% fabric yield efficiency while cutting patterns with 0.1mm margin precision, sealing raw edge fibers to prevent fraying on 3-Layer hard shell laminates.
Every needle hole is sealed using Japanese high-pressure hot-air seam-sealing machinery. We utilize 13mm to 22mm TPU/PU waterproof tapes tested under static water columns before final assembly.
Fully automated, enclosed micro-gram weighing down filling units prevent plumage airborne contamination while guaranteeing exact density distribution across box-wall baffles.
